Data and Code for: Analysis of Magnetocrystalline Anisotropy from Atom Pair Statistics in Tetragonally Strained Fe-Based Alloys: A First-Principles and Machine Learning Study All processed datasets and code used to generate the figures and analysis in this work will be made publicly available in an online repository upon acceptance. Due to the large file size of the VASP (first-principles calculation) raw outputs, these files are not deposited directly but can be provided by the corresponding author upon reasonable request.
